BridgeSpan Named One of Nation's Top Five ``Most Important'' Mortgage Innovations; Company's Innovative Use of Technology is Bringing New Efficiencies to the Mortgage Process.


Business Editors/Real Estate Writers

MOUNTAIN VIEW,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--April 16, 2003

BridgeSpan Inc., a company helping to transform the mortgage lending and closing process, has been nationally recognized for its technology being one of the "five most important innovations" in the mortgage industry.

    About BridgeSpan

    BridgeSpan is a leading provider of real estate settlement and mortgage processing solutions for lenders. These solutions improve the mortgage closing process, reduce transaction costs Transaction Costs
